- The distance between Stuttgart, Germany and Ternopil, Ukraine is approximately 1,200 km or 745 mi.
- To reach Stuttgart in this distance one would set out from Ternopil bearing 272.2°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Stuttgart bearing 259.7° or W .
- Stuttgart has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Ternopil has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 2.9 °C (5.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.1 °C (7.4°F) less in Stuttgart.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 78 mm (3.1 in) more which is equivalent to 78 l/m² (1.91 US gal/ft²) or 780,000 l/ha (83,387 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.8° higher in Stuttgart than in Ternopil.
